Excellent. I switched to using Red Spotted Hanky after South West Trains (who offer a higher cashback), stopped tracking any of my transactions. Red Spotted Hanky does not charge any booking fees, provide free first class delivery (or collection from train station) and exceptionally fast tracking. All my transactions (about 10 so far) have been tracked within the hour. Furthermore, Red Spotted Hanky's website also has an additional loyalty system. Loyalty points can be redeemed with various vendors, and if redeemed on train fares equate to the equivalent of 1% "cashback", bringing the total cashback up to 2.5% which is much more competitive than 1.51%!!
I am very happy with their customer service to date, now I just need to wait for the cashback to be paid :D

I am so happy RSH are doing cashback again!
I used them for a while, as I commute to london on the trains everyday I buy a lot of tickets.
They make it so clear what journeys have the cheapest tickets and it will give 1 reference for several journeys (I buy 10 single tickets at a time) to make it easy for collection.
I recieved money back when trains were being disrupted with snow, quickly and efficently, the lady was also lovely.
I will always use Red Spotted Hanky from now on, I used TheTrainLine for cashback last time but they gave me a different reference number for every single journey and then they charge booking fees too so you actually end up paying more.
No booking fees on RSH, Even for credit cards.

I've been using RSH for a while now, and had to cancel one of my purchases (one ticket out of four going). RSH were very helpful and although they make a charge for refunding, they sorted it out and reimbursed me within a short while. It is such a shame they no longer offer TCB
Not only do RSH offer competitive prices, but they also give you FREE first class delivery, and Reward points which can be added and donated to 'the railway children' charity or used against you purchase.
Another great thing to remember is that if you shop with Tesco, you can double up your Clubcard points at RSH (so £10 in clubcard points becomes £20 to spend at RSH), I have also done this a few times, and saved a packet. They also give out free money into your RSH on their Facebook pages sometimes.
Overall a company that has always dealt with my queries excellently, offered good prices, and free delivery. highly recommend!
